1. What are Biore Pore Strips and how do they work?
Biore is a well-known Japanese skincare brand under Kao Corporation, established in the late 1980s. Over the years, Biore has become synonymous with pore care, oil control, and blackhead removal, with their pore strips being one of their best-selling products.
Biore Pore Strips are adhesive patches designed to stick to the skin, particularly on the nose, chin, or forehead. When removed, the strip pulls out debris such as sebum plugs, blackheads, and dead skin cells that clog pores. Many Biore Nose Strips review posts highlight how satisfying it feels to see visible results after a single use.
The strips are made of a strong polymer adhesive combined with water-activated bonding agents. Some versions are infused with witch hazel or tea tree oil for extra soothing benefits. This mix is what makes Biore one of the most effective drugstore Biore blackhead remover products available.
Biore Pore Strips became popular not only in Japan but also internationally, thanks to their affordability, availability in drugstores, and the instant satisfaction they provide.
2. Biore pore strips review: Do Biore Pore Strips work?
So, the big question remains: do they really work? Let’s break it down.
2.1 Instantly removes blackheads and excess oil
One of the main reasons people love Biore strips is the instant gratification. Within just 10–15 minutes, the strip dries and clings to impurities. When peeled off, it visibly removes blackheads and excess oil from the pores. Many Biore Nose Strips review articles emphasize the dramatic difference after one use, especially for oily skin types.
However, the results are surface-level. The strips pull out what’s on the top of the pore but do not prevent future blackheads from forming.
Another benefit is the immediate improvement in pore visibility. Right after using a strip, pores often look smaller and the skin feels smoother. This effect, however, is temporary. Over time, without consistent care, pores can become clogged again.
Dermatologists often note that pore strips are best viewed as a cosmetic quick fix rather than a long-term treatment. Still, for those seeking a cleaner, fresher look before an event, the strips deliver on their promise.

4. How did I use Biore Pore Strips for the best results?
For this Biore pore strips review, I followed the instructions carefully to maximize the outcome.
Here are the steps:
Cleanse your face with a gentle cleanser to remove oil and dirt.
Wet your nose thoroughly, as the strip only adheres to damp skin.
Apply the strip smoothly, pressing down to ensure good contact.
Leave it on for 10–15 minutes until the strip becomes stiff.
Gently peel it off from both sides toward the center.
Rinse off any residue and apply a soothing toner or moisturizer.
Pro tips:
Do not use it more than once every three days to avoid irritation.
Apply a warm towel before use to open pores for better results.
Follow with a hydrating mask to calm the skin.
Combine with a clay mask or salicylic acid routine to prevent blackheads from returning.

FAQs - People also ask about the Biore pore strips review
Below are some frequently asked questions about Biore Pore Strips, offering insights into their effectiveness, usage, and important considerations.
Do Biore strips really work?
Yes, Biore strips do work by physically pulling out blackheads, oil, and debris from the pores. However, the results are temporary, and consistent skincare is needed to prevent blackheads from returning.
Do dermatologists recommend pore strips?
Dermatologists often say pore strips are safe for occasional use but not as a long-term treatment. They are best seen as a cosmetic fix rather than a cure for blackheads.
Why won’t my blackheads come out with pore strips?
If blackheads are deep or hardened, pore strips may not remove them completely. Prepping the skin with warm water or steam can help loosen them for better results.
What are the negatives of pore strips?
Pore strips can sometimes cause irritation, redness, or dryness, especially for sensitive skin. They also do not prevent blackheads from reforming, making them a short-term solution.
Are Biore Pore Strips safe during pregnancy?
Yes, Biore strips are generally safe to use during pregnancy, as they work mechanically and do not contain strong active chemicals. However, if your skin becomes extra sensitive, limit usage.
Are Biore Pore Strips vegan?
Some Biore products are vegan-friendly, but not all. It’s best to check the packaging or official website for specific formulations.
Do Biore strips make your pores bigger?
No, Biore strips do not enlarge pores. They temporarily make pores look smaller by removing debris. Over time, however, blackheads can reappear if the skin is not maintained properly.
